What is ANM qualification
ANM or Auxiliary Nursing Midwifery is a two-year diploma Programme in the field of Nursing . Interested candidates can apply for an ANM diploma after passing their class 12 exam with Science or Arts stream. The two-year course includes six months of compulsory internship

What are ANM Nursing Courses?
ANM or Auxiliary Nursing Midwifery is primarily a diploma course, focusing on the study of the health of mankind. Besides, while learning this course, candidates are also taught regarding the Operation Theatre, its functioning, various equipments, and how to handle them. The significant motive of the ANM course is to train the candidates in functioning as a basic health worker in the society, and give treatment to children, women, and aged people.
Generally, Child Health Nursing, Health Promotion, Midwifery, Health Care Management, Primary and Community Health Nursing, are the subjects of ANM. An aspirant desiring to pursue this course needs to have patience, should be alert, physically fit, and have responsibility. ANM has good career scope as well, and has multiple job opportunities, in various areas, including NGOs, Government Hospitals, Nursing Homes, Private Hospitals, etc.

ANM Nursing Admission Process
Aspirants seeking admission for the ANM program, will be admitted based on their performance in the common entrance exams. Direct admission facilities are also available in some colleges.
Direct admission process is seen in most of the ANM colleges in India.
Here, candidates will be picked up based on their scores that they have acquired in the intermediate exams.
If their scores are better than the cut off marks, released by the college, they will be eligible to get permission for admission.
Also, there is merit-based admission in some of the colleges, which are done via conducting entrance exams.
There also, a specific cut off marks will be given, where the candidates need to score more than that, and be eligible to get admission.

ANM Nursing Course in IGNOU
Indira Gandhi National Open University or IGNOU provides the ANM program, where the course span ranges from 6 months to 2 years. The course fee for ANM at the IGNOU is INR 6,700, and there is no restriction on the minimum or maximum age limit.
Admission Process
Candidates can apply at the official website of the college, for the specific course they want to pursue, i.e., ANM.
The eligible candidates will be shortlisted for the next round of admission. The minimum eligibility for this course at the institution is qualifying for the ANM, with a minimum of two or three years of working experience.
Selected candidates can check their names on the list, issued by the college.

ANM Jobs
There are multiple job opportunities for the ones who completed the ANM course. They can either work as a Home Nurse, or Community Health Worker, Rural Health Worker, or Basic Health Worker. The various job profiles that a candidate can get into along with its recruiters have been mentioned below.
